WebYou can do triangulation in two main ways: Use a combination of primary and secondary data. Use two (or more) primary data sources. Technically, you can use multiple secondary data sources to triangulate, but it’s always better to have a primary data source. This is because primary data is much more reliable and can be better controlled.
